Balance Customer Needs and Sales Goals

You must understand that the customer isn’t always right when achieving sales targets. Respecting and attending to their needs is essential, but agreeing to every request blindly just for sale will not lead to success. Top-performing salespeople recognize that honesty and clear communication build lasting client relationships. Do not lie to your customers and present genuine solutions to their problems.

Sometimes, customers have specific ideas that might not align with their best interests. As trusted advisors, salespeople use their product knowledge to steer customers away from wrong choices, guiding them towards better-fitting solutions. This approach helps create fruitful and healthy relationships with customers while ensuring the salesperson’s success.

Embrace the Power of Uncertainty in Sales

For successful sale sales approaches, don’t shy away from admitting “I don’t know” if you have limited or no knowledge about the product or service. Embrace the confidence to acknowledge gaps in knowledge and propose a swift follow-up: “Let me check and get back to you.” This simple act nurtures a heightened level of trust with clients. It assures them of the accuracy of your past responses, fostering transparency. Fulfilling your commitment to helping customers with their queries earns respect and sustains a relationship founded on integrity.
